USD/CAD Surges to Two-Month High as Bulls Eye Further Breakout Amid Geopolitical Uncertainty

The USD/CAD currency pair extended its weekly uptrend for the fourth consecutive day, reaching a more than two-month high during the early European session on Thursday. Spot prices traded around the 1.3820 region, marking a 0.10% increase for the day, with technical indicators suggesting further appreciation is likely [1]. Persistent geopolitical uncertainties have strengthened the US Dollar's position as the global reserve currency, while elevated energy prices have fueled inflation concerns and increased expectations for a more hawkish US Federal Reserve. These factors have provided additional support for the USD and the USD/CAD pair [1].

Technical analysis reveals a breakout through the 50% Fibonacci retracement level of the November-January decline and a move above the 200-day Exponential Moving Average (EMA), which are seen as key triggers for USD/CAD bulls. The momentum remains positive, with the MACD line above the signal line and a modestly positive histogram. The Relative Strength Index (RSI) at 67 indicates firm upside pressure but remains below overbought territory, validating the near-term bullish outlook. Initial resistance is identified at the 61.8% Fibonacci retracement level at 1.3882, followed by the 78.6% level at 1.3990, which are the next upside targets if buyers maintain control [1].

On the downside, immediate support is at the 50% retracement level at 1.3806. A break below this could expose the 38.2% retracement at 1.3729, with prior reaction highs adding significance. Further downside could see the 23.6% retracement at 1.3635, which would undermine the current bullish tone [1].

The US Dollar was the strongest against the New Zealand Dollar today, with a 0.14% gain, and showed a 0.06% increase against the Canadian Dollar. The heat map of major currencies indicates the USD's relative strength across the board, supporting the bullish momentum in USD/CAD [1].
